Tivo box connection

Hi. Since approx a week ago my Tivo boxes which were working perfectly have stopped speaking to each other.

1 upstairs, 1 downstairs connected wirelessly. Never had any issues with the setup until a week ago.

Rebooting boxes doesn't solve problem. I Can see boxes but I just get the spinning wheel as it tries to connect.

Re: Tivo box connection

Do you get any error messages/codes when trying to multi-room stream?

Can both your V6 use OnDemand services OK? That's a good test of the V6 <--> Hub connection.

What's the signal strength of the wireless connected V6? Home > Help & Settings > Settings > Network.
